Plant Phenotyping Market is anticipated to reach USD 686.8 million by 2030
The plant phenotyping Market is
predicted to grow from USD 238.9 million in 2021 to USD 686.8 million in 2030,
at a CAGR of 12.8% during the forecast period. The market for plant phenotyping
is anticipated to grow over the course of the forecast period as a result of an
increasing trend among commercial plant breeders and plant-based science
research organizations to use plant phenotyping services. In order to reproduce
the perfect environment for plant phenotyping, there has been cooperation
between plant phenotyping businesses for the integration of analysis tools and
parameters.

Growth
Drivers:
The United Nations (UN) predicts that by 2050, there will
be 9.7 billion people on the planet. As a result of this projected population
growth, there will be a greater demand for food globally, which will increase
the need for cutting-edge agricultural techniques like plant phenotyping to
produce crops with higher yields and higher quality.
Food waste is being caused by an increase in seed-borne
illnesses, hence methods like plant phenotyping are needed to identify diseases
early and aid in the selection of disease-free plant breeds. Pathogens that
cause illness can spread through seed dispersal, and when the environment is
right for them, they can then infect growing seedlings.
